It is a single purchase for all devices and NOT a subscription. After that, you can either purchase a full version or access your data in a read-only mode. ![]() You can download and try Taskheat for free for two weeks. You can pick up the latest version of your task flow on any device. Taskheat uses iCloud to synchronize your projects between your Mac, iPhone, or iPad.
